COLUMBUS, OH, January 16, 2024 - Planet TV Studios, a leading creator of cutting edge television series, proudly announces its newest documentary series, "New Frontiers," featuring the revolutionary accomplishments of Andelyn Biosciences. This unique documentary will discuss the breakthrough strides created by Andelyn Biosciences, a major gene therapy Contract Development and Manufacturing Organization (CDMO), in the developing space of biotechnology.
"New Frontiers" is a thought-provoking series meticulously engineered to delve into groundbreaking organizations that happen to be at the forefront of shaping the foreseeable future of healthcare internationally. The documentary episodes will be airing early 2024 on national television, Bloomberg TV, and readily available on on-demand through a number of platforms, including Amazon, Google Play, Roku, and more.

Through the complex industry of biotechnology, Andelyn Biosciences has appeared as a forerunner, developing revolutionary therapies and contributing drastically to the biopharmaceutical market. Started in 2020, the business, headquartered in Columbus, Ohio, started out of Nationwide Children's Hospital's Abigail Wexner Research Institute having a vision to speeding up the advancement and manufacturing of innovative therapies to bring more treatments to more patients.
Key Focus Areas:
Cell and Gene Therapies: Andelyn Biosciences has specialized within the progression and manufacturing of cell and gene therapies, genetically engineering therapies or cures for target diseases such as genetic disorders, cancer, and autoimmune conditions.
Bioprocessing and Manufacturing: Andelyn exceeds expectation in bioprocessing and manufacturing technologies, making sure the cost-efficient and scalable manufacturing of gene therapies.

Viral Vectors
Pathogens have adapted to effectively transport DNA sequences into target cells, establishing them as a viable method for genetic modification. Common biological delivery agents consist of:
Adenoviruses – Able to penetrate both proliferating and non-dividing cells but often trigger immune responses.
Adeno-Associated Viruses (AAVs) – Preferred due to their reduced immune response and capacity for maintaining long-term gene expression.
Retroviruses and Lentiviruses – Incorporate into the cellular DNA, offering sustained transcription, with lentiviruses being particularly beneficial for altering dormant cellular structures.
Synthetic Gene Transport Mechanisms
Alternative gene transport techniques provide a safer alternative, reducing the risk of immune reactions. These comprise:
Liposomes and Nanoparticles – Encapsulating nucleic acids for efficient internalization.
Electropulse Gene Transfer – Applying electric shocks to create temporary pores in cell membranes, facilitating DNA/RNA penetration.
Targeted Genetic Infusion – Administering DNA sequences straight into target tissues.

DNA-Based Oncology Solutions
DNA-based interventions are crucial in tumor management, either by engineering lymphocytes to target malignant cells or by directly altering cancerous cells to inhibit their growth. Some of the most promising tumor-targeted genetic solutions feature:
CAR-T Cell Therapy – Genetically engineered T cells targeting specific cancer antigens.
Oncolytic Viruses – Engineered viruses that selectively infect and destroy tumor cells.
Tumor Suppressor Gene Therapy – Reviving the activity of tumor-suppressing DNA sequences to control proliferation.

Genetic Engineering Solutions: Altering the Human DNA
Gene therapy achieves results by altering the fundamental issue of inherited disorders:
In-Body Gene Treatment: Administers DNA sequences directly into the organism, notably the FDA-approved vision-restoring Luxturna for managing genetic vision loss.
External Genetic Modification: Involves genetically altering a subject’s genetic material outside the system and then returning them, as demonstrated by some emerging solutions for hereditary blood ailments and immunodeficiencies.
The advent of cutting-edge CRISPR technology has dramatically improved gene therapy studies, facilitating precise modifications at the molecular structure.

Tumor Therapies
The sanction of CAR-T cell therapies like Novartis’ Kymriah and Gilead’s Yescarta has revolutionized the oncology field, especially for individuals with aggressive lymphomas who have no viable remaining treatments.
